Hi,This should be an easy one. I purchased ASV and then upgraded to ASV enhanced. Do to other computer issues, I decided to reformat my hardrive and rebuild my system. In the meantime you released ASV6 and ASV6 upgrade 2. My question is, what is the reinstall process from here? Should I reinstall all 4 in the order that they were released, just ASV and AS6 upgrade 2, or something in between?Also I have a registered version of FSUIPC 3.50. Is version 3.53 needed or does it offer any benefits for AS6UG2? FS2004 is working very well now and I have decided to stop being a mechanic and become a pilot again. In other words, minimize the tweaking, if it runs well, leave it alone.Thanks,Ted

Hi Ted,The free upgrade to ASv6 requires ASV (or ASVE) be installed. So:1) Install ASV from your original installation backup, or contact us at support@hifisim.com if you need a new download.2) Install ASv6 unwrapper for ASV/E users from http://sales.hifisim.com/downloads.htm3) Install the latest SU2 patch also available from the above download link.3.53 is highly recommended. There were some problems in earlier versions with wind depiction. I THINK this was related to 3.51 only (so technically 3.50 should be ok) but I do know that 3.53 is the only latest "supported" version that appears to have no problems :) http://www.schiratti.com/dowson.htmlBest,
